Classic Winged Eyeliner

A timeless classic, the winged eyeliner creates an illusion of larger eyes by extending the natural line of your eye outward. This technique not only enhances the eyes but also adds a touch of glamour to any look. Perfect for both day and night, the winged eyeliner is versatile and can be adjusted based on the thickness and length of the wing.
For those new to this style, starting with a thin line can make the process more manageable. Gradually building up the thickness allows for greater control and precision.
Pair your winged eyeliner with a nude lip and light eyeshadow for a balanced and sophisticated appearance. Try experimenting with colors like navy or brown for a unique twist.
Smoky Eye Magic

The smoky eye is a bold and dramatic look that can easily be adapted to highlight small eyes. By concentrating darker shades on the outer corners and blending well, you can create depth and dimension. This technique works wonders in drawing attention to your eyes, making them appear larger and more intriguing.
It’s essential to balance a smoky eye with neutral tones on the rest of your face. A subtle blush and a natural lip color can complement the intensity of the eyes.
Experiment with different color palettes like charcoal, deep plum, or navy to suit your skin tone and personal style. Smoky eyes are perfect for a night out or special occasion.
Pearl White Elegance

Pearl white eyeshadow is a simple yet effective way to make small eyes appear more open and awake. By applying this shimmering shade to the inner corners and center of the eyelids, you can create a bright and ethereal effect.
This look is particularly suitable for daytime wear or casual events, offering a touch of elegance without overwhelming the face. Pairing it with a soft pink or coral lipstick enhances the overall freshness of the appearance.
If you’re feeling adventurous, add a hint of silver or light gold to the lower lash line for extra sparkle. This technique is a favorite for those seeking a subtle enhancement with minimal effort.

Soft Halo Eyes

Soft halo eyes offer a dreamy and enchanting look for small eyes by using a shimmering eyeshadow that surrounds the entire eye. By applying a lighter shade in the center of the lid and blending darker tones around it, you create a halo effect that draws attention inward.
This technique creates a sense of depth and mystery, perfect for evening events or romantic occasions. Pairing it with a soft lip color and subtle blush enhances the ethereal quality of the makeup.
To add a personal touch, experiment with different shades like rose gold, lavender, or champagne. The soft halo eye is versatile and adaptable to various styles and preferences.

Winged Cut Crease

The winged cut crease is a modern and sophisticated technique that accentuates small eyes by adding definition and depth. By creating a sharp line that separates the lid from the crease and extending it outward, you create an elongated effect that enhances the eye shape.
This style is perfect for those seeking a dramatic and polished look, particularly suited for evening wear or special occasions. Pairing it with a bold lip color can elevate the overall glamor.
Experiment with different color combinations to find the one that best complements your skin tone and personal style. The winged cut crease offers endless possibilities for creativity and expression.

Floating Eyeliner

Floating eyeliner is a trendy and innovative technique that draws attention to small eyes by placing the liner above the natural crease. This creates an illusion of larger and more open eyes, perfect for those looking to make a bold statement.
Pair this look with minimal face makeup to ensure the eyes remain the focal point. It’s ideal for those who love experimenting with modern and edgy styles.
Floating eyeliner works well with various colors and shapes, offering endless possibilities for creativity. It’s a fantastic choice for fashion-forward individuals who enjoy breaking the norms and setting trends.

Tightline Technique

The tightline technique is a subtle yet effective way to enhance small eyes by applying eyeliner to the upper waterline. This method creates the illusion of fuller lashes and a more defined eye shape without the heaviness of traditional eyeliner.
Ideal for everyday wear, this technique adds a polished and refined touch to your look. Pair it with a light coat of mascara and neutral eyeshadow for a seamless finish.
The tightline technique is versatile and can be customized to suit different eye shapes and personal preferences. It’s a must-try for those who appreciate understated elegance in their makeup routine.
Kajal Kohl Charm

Kajal kohl eyeliner offers a deep and intense way to accentuate small eyes, drawing from traditional beauty practices. This style involves applying a rich, black kohl to the waterline and around the eyes, creating a captivating and dramatic look.
Perfect for those who love bold and striking makeup, kajal kohl can be paired with minimal face makeup to let the eyes take center stage. Its versatility allows for both casual and formal looks.
Experiment with different styles and intensities to find the one that best reflects your personality and cultural influences. Kajal kohl remains a timeless favorite for its ability to transform and enhance the eyes.
